HTC patents new QWERTY slider design
Will make for smaller smartphones

17 March 2008 9:17 GMT / By Amy-Mae Elliott
By making the numeric keypad a part of the QWERTY keyboard plate and having the phone display covering most of QWERTY keyboard, except for the numeric bit in closed mode, this new patent design from HTC could slim down smartphones.
To open the device into the landscape QWERTY mode, just slide the screen diagonally across the keyboard plate and fix the display in the top/middle of it. Tidy idea, huh?
